How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aldershot?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Aldershot 1 Bedroom Apartments | C$2,053 | C$1,809 | C$2,315 |
Aldershot 2 Bedroom Apartments | C$2,523 | C$2,185 | C$3,150 |
Aldershot 3 Bedroom Apartments | C$3,061 | C$2,849 | C$3,695 |
